Chihuahua vs Dachshund
Toy · Toy vs Hound · Small
ChihuahuaToy
A graceful, charming, sassy tiny dog of Mexican origin — the world's smallest breed, big in personality.
Weight: 6 lbsLifespan: 14–16 years
DachshundSmall
A spirited, clever, courageous badger-hunter on stubby legs — the iconic 'wiener dog'.
Weight: 16–32 lbsLifespan: 12–16 years
Quick take
- • Dachshund is the larger breed at 16–32 lbs (males) vs 6 lbs for the Chihuahua.
- • The Chihuahua typically lives longer (14–16 years).
- • The Chihuahua sheds less.

About the Chihuahua
The Chihuahua is a graceful, charming, sassy tiny dog of Mexican origin — the world's smallest breed, big in personality. Originally from Mexico, this toy toy breed typically weighs 6 lbs and lives 14–16 years. Breeders describe them as graceful, charming, sassy.
About the Dachshund
The Dachshund is a spirited, clever, courageous badger-hunter on stubby legs — the iconic 'wiener dog'. Originally from Germany, this small hound breed typically weighs 16–32 lbs and lives 12–16 years. Breeders describe them as spunky, curious, friendly.

Chihuahua health
Common health concerns reported in this breed:
- • Patellar luxation
- • Hydrocephalus
- • Heart disease
- • Dental issues
Dachshund health
Common health concerns reported in this breed:
- • IVDD (back problems)
- • Obesity
- • Patellar luxation
- • Diabetes
